Transaction 75488d87f51b65145147970b293f024598dc77eb826724ffc0015d2229cd529a
1 Input
2 Outputs
- 75488d87f51b65145147970b293f024598dc77eb826724ffc0015d2229cd529a:0
- 75488d87f51b65145147970b293f024598dc77eb826724ffc0015d2229cd529a:1
value 2489973100
address 128gYoUoWhwVK7x1vKY3A8jiFZ55VxRVgd
value 281448
address 1FmnXKdwcN19Xw4dHaoCvX1ev6cGUxJeBQ